Chinese Porcelain Vase, Possibly Yongzheng Period (1723-35)
of baluster form with blue and white decoration of a man riding a dragon, a lady riding a phoenix and courtiers in a garden landscape, this story depicted on this vase is likely a romantic tale about Nong Yu and Xiao Shi, bearing zhuanshu seal of the Yongzheng Emperor to the underside
- Measurements:
- height 46 cm
